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Ecureuil de finlayson | robust pillar snail |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(animal) | Animalia (animal)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Mollusca (mollusques) |
| Class | Mammalia (mammifères) | Gastropoda (Gastropoda)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Stylommatophora (Stylommatophora) |
| Family | Sciuridae (Squirrels) | Cochlicopidae |
| Genus | Callosciurus | Cochlicopa |
| Species | Callosciurus finlaysonii | Cochlicopa nitens |
